Abstract

PROBLEM TO BE SOLVED: To provide a business model of a watch system in a housing complex, which is configured to form a community in a district with elderly residents of a housing complex as targets, watch each other by mutual aid of local residents and support human watch by local residents of the housing complex by mechanical watch by a sensor from the side, and is operated by healthy elderly residents.SOLUTION: In the watch system of a housing complex, an intra-dwelling-unit watch device comprising a sensor for gathering living information is installed inside each dwelling unit of the housing complex, the living information from each dwelling unit is gathered to mechanical watch means installed in a security center of the housing complex, and mutual human watch situations outside the dwelling units are inputted to the mechanical watch means. In the security center, the living information of elderly residents and presence/absence of abnormal change are checked about twice a day. In the case that the abnormal change is recognized from human watch and mechanical watch, someone rushes over from the security center to judge the situations and give various kinds of support.

近年、少子高齢化社会が進みつつあり、子供たちの生活を尊重したいなどの理由で独居を選ぶ高齢者が増加している。このため、都市部では地域コミュニティが希薄になると共に人的交流が疎遠になりがちになり、隣家の異変に気付き難くなっている。古くからの団地では、高齢者夫婦だけや高齢独居者の割合が数10%にもなって来ており、お互いに見守る自助努力が求められるが、訪問などによる人的見守りを少なくでき、かつ住み慣れた地域で安心して暮らせるコミュニティー作りが必要とされてきている。最近の見守りシステムとして訪問介護や訪問サービス等の人的見守りや日常使われている水道や電気ポットを利用した機械的生活見守りシステムが従来技術として知られている。本発明に関する先行技術文献として、下記のものがある。  In recent years, an aging society with a declining birthrate is progressing, and an increasing number of elderly people choose to live alone because they want to respect their lives. For this reason, in urban areas, local communities are becoming sparse and human exchanges tend to be estranged, making it difficult to notice changes in neighbors. In old housing estates, the ratio of elderly couples and elderly singles has reached several tens of percent, and self-help efforts are required to watch each other. There is a need to create a community where people can live with peace of mind. As a recent monitoring system, a conventional monitoring system is known as a personal monitoring system such as a home care service or a visiting service, or a mechanical life monitoring system using a water supply or an electric kettle that is used daily. Prior art documents relating to the present invention include the following.

特開2002−74561号報JP 2002-74561 A 特開2006−65886号報JP 2006-65886 A

上記文献のようなICTを用いた生活見守りシステムでは、営利を目的とした運用が行われること、通信の手段として公衆回線が使われることなどから利用料金が高くなる。また、遠隔看護者に対してレポートされるが異変時に対して的確でかつ早い対応は難しい。更に、センサを用いた機械的見守りシステムだけでは十分とは言い難い。そこで、本発明は、団地の高齢居住者を対象として地域でコミュニティーを形成し、お互いの見守りを地域住民の共助で行い、団地の地域住民による人的見守りをセンサーによる機械的見守りが側面からサポートするように構成し、元気な高齢居住者が運用する団地内見守りシステムのビジネスモデルを提供することである。  In the life monitoring system using the ICT as described in the above document, the usage fee is high because operation for the purpose of profit is performed and a public line is used as a communication means. In addition, although it is reported to remote nurses, it is difficult to respond accurately and quickly to an emergency. Furthermore, it is difficult to say that a mechanical monitoring system using a sensor alone is sufficient. Therefore, the present invention forms a community in the community for elderly residents of the housing complex, watches each other with the help of the local residents, and supports the human monitoring by the local residents of the housing complex from the side by mechanical monitoring using sensors. This is to provide a business model of the residential area monitoring system operated by energetic elderly residents.

本発明は、上記従来の課題を解決するためになされたものであり、団地の各住戸内に、生活情報を収集するセンサからなる住戸内見守り装置と団地の安心センターに設置された機械的見守り手段に各住戸からの生活情報が集められると共に、住戸外でのお互いの人的見守り状況が機械的見守り手段に入力されるように構成され、安心センターでは1日に2回程度、高齢居住者の生活情報や異変の有無がチェックできるようにし、人的見守りと機械的見守りから異変が認められる場合には、安心センターから駆けつけて状況判断や各種支援が行えるようにして、この安心センターの運用は団地の元気な高齢居住者、自治会、NPO法人などの地域住民で行われるようにした団地の見守りシステムのビジネスモデルである。  The present invention has been made in order to solve the above-described conventional problems, and in each dwelling unit of the housing complex, a dwelling unit monitoring device comprising sensors for collecting life information and a mechanical monitoring unit installed in the security center of the housing complex. Life information from each dwelling unit is collected in the means, and each person's personal watching situation outside the dwelling unit is input to the mechanical watching means. The safety center can be checked to see if there are any changes in life information, and if there are any changes from human or mechanical monitoring, the safety center will be able to determine the situation and provide various support. Is a business model of the estate monitoring system that is performed by local residents such as healthy elderly residents, residents' associations, and NPO corporations.

本発明の団地内見守りシステムのビジネスモデルによれば、団地内の安心センターにコミュニティーが形成され、団地の高齢居住者が安心センターに憩いの場所として集まり易くなり、訪問による安否確認を少なくでき、また見守りを団地の高齢居住者の共助で行うことができので、住み慣れた団地で安心して暮らせるつながりをつくることができる。更に、センサーによる機械的見守りが人的見守りをサポートするように構成されるので、より早く、より確実に団地の高齢居住者の異変に気付くことができると共に、見守り活動の労力を軽減でき、かつ安心センターの運用は団地の元気な高齢居住者、自治会、NPO法人などの地域住民で行われるようにしたので、団地の高齢居住者の異変把握の確実性が高くなり、孤独死を防止する予防的な取り組みが可能となる。更に、ローカルエリアネットワークを用いた機械的見守りシステムとしているので通信費が不要となる。  According to the business model of the housing estate monitoring system of the present invention, a community is formed in the safety center in the housing complex, and it becomes easier for elderly residents of the housing complex to gather as a resting place in the safety center, and safety confirmation by visiting can be reduced, In addition, since it is possible to watch over with the help of elderly residents in the housing complex, it is possible to create a connection where people can live with peace in the housing complex they are accustomed to living. Furthermore, since the mechanical monitoring by the sensor is configured to support human monitoring, it is possible to notice the change of elderly residents in the housing complex more quickly and more reliably, and reduce the labor of the monitoring activities, and Since the operation of the safety center was carried out by local residents such as healthy elderly residents, residents' associations, NPO corporations, etc., the reliability of the elderly residents in the estate became more reliable and prevented lonely death Preventive efforts are possible. Furthermore, since it is a mechanical monitoring system using a local area network, communication costs are not required.

The dwelling unit monitoring device 19 in the A complex 23 has turned on / off a human sensor for detecting a resident's movement, a remote control operation sensor for detecting operation of a remote control such as a television or an air conditioner, or an illumination lamp. The living information of the resident obtained from the living information sensor 1 including the living behavior sensor for detecting the living behavior of the resident such as a lighting on / off sensor for detecting the resident is input to the controller 4 and accumulated in the storage means 5. The outing sensor 2 for detecting that the resident has gone out is composed of a human sensor in the vicinity of the door and an entrance door opening / closing switch means. Or you may comprise the going-out sensor 2 with the going-out confirmation lock from which a switch signal is output when the entrance door is locked from the outside. The output of the outing sensor 2 is also accumulated in the storage means 5 of the controller 4. The resident's life information stored in the storage means 5 and the outing information from the outing sensor 2 communicate with the second communication interface means 9 via the first communication interface means 8 through communication means. Is input to the mechanical monitoring means 10 installed in the safety center 22. The dwelling unit monitoring devices 19 to 21 installed in each dwelling unit in the housing complex regularly send the resident's life information obtained from the life information sensor 1 to the mechanical monitoring unit 10 in the safety center 22 through communication means ( For example, every hour), and the mechanical monitoring means 10 is configured to collect and accumulate the resident's life information and to display the accumulated life information in chronological order. If the resident's life information cannot be obtained, an alarm is output. Between the first communication interface means 8 and the second communication interface means 9, a local area network is constituted by a communication means of a wireless personal area network (wireless PAN) or a wireless local area network (wireless LAN). Here, a Zigbee (registered trademark) terminal is used for the first communication interface means 8 and a Zigbee (registered trademark) coordinator is used for the second communication interface means 9 to form a wireless PAN. This local area network may be constituted by a wireless LAN. As described above, in the communication means configured by the local area network, there is no communication fee between the monitoring device 19 in the dwelling unit and the mechanical monitoring means 10 in the safety center 22, so that it can be easily introduced into each dwelling unit. Become. The mechanical watching means 10 installed in the security center 22 of the A complex 23 is constituted by a server, and a keyboard 11, a handwritten tablet 12 as an input means for human watching information memos, and a help desk terminal 13 are connected. Furthermore, cameras 18 are installed at the entrances and exits of roads that lead to the outside from the housing complex, and video information from the camera 18 is input to the mechanical monitoring means 10, recorded, and the housing complex elderly residents went out, or the housing complex Watching information such as coming back to can be obtained. Furthermore, the mechanical monitoring means 10 can send monitoring information as necessary to a public corporation that owns a plurality of housing complexes or a management center 26 such as a local government through the public communication network 25 such as the Internet or a mobile phone. In the B complex 24, the same monitoring as the A complex 23 is performed, and the monitoring information of the B complex 24 is sent to the complex management center 26 via the public communication network 25 as necessary. The service menu display terminal 3 is connected to the controller 4 in the dwelling unit monitoring device 19. The service menu display terminal 3 has a touch panel, and various menus that can be requested from the safety center 22 are displayed as buttons. When the resident touches the button of the item he wants to request, this requested item information (desired service information) is input to the controller 4 and input to the mechanical monitoring means 10 in the safety center 22 via the communication means comprising the local area network. The desired service information which is request item information from the dwelling unit monitoring device 19 is output and displayed on the help desk terminal 13. Since the dwelling unit monitoring device 19 has an ID, it can be known from which dwelling unit the request is made. Since the service menu display terminal 3 simply touches the request item of the menu displayed so that an elderly resident can use, the details of the request content correspond to the telephone from the help desk having the help desk terminal 13 in the safety center 22 You can get shopping support after confirmation. In this way, processing of desired service information by the operator of the help desk terminal 13 is performed. The help desk terminal 13 is configured to be able to obtain various kinds of information useful for the elderly from the living information center 27 and support such as ticket purchase from the outside via the Internet or a public communication network 25 such as a mobile phone. A memorandum of watching by people between the elderly residents in the estate, such as patrols and visits within the estate, or gatherings in the security center 22, is provided as the mechanical monitoring means 10 via the handwritten tablet 12 as the input means as human monitoring information. Input and accumulate. Various voice information is input from the keyboard 11 to the mechanical monitoring means 10 as text data and stored. Various kinds of audio information are input from the mechanical monitoring means 10 into the dwelling unit monitoring device 19 via the communication means between the second communication interface means 9 and the first communication interface means 8, and through the voice synthesizing means 6. A sound for calling out to the elderly residents is outputted from the speaker 7 every morning, and guidance information and life support information such as holding an event, selling daily necessities, various notifications and the like are outputted by voice. As described above, the voice guidance is performed so that the elderly residents are more likely to gather at the safety center 22 outside the dwelling by outputting various kinds of voice information from the speaker 7. The dwelling unit monitoring devices 20 and 21 have the same function, and are attached to each dwelling unit in the housing complex. There is a cafeteria 14 in the safety center 22 where meals taking into account the health of elderly residents in the housing complex are provided every day and household goods are also sold. Furthermore, various event holdings 15 and the blue sky market 16 are also held as needed. Here, the operation of the mechanical monitoring means 10 in the safety center 22 and the input of the personal monitoring memo from the handwritten tablet 12, the operation and various support of the help desk terminal 13, the operation of the cafeteria 14, the event holding 15 and the blue sky market The operation of the safety center 22 such as the operation of 16 and the personal monitoring of the elderly residents are performed by the local residents of healthy elderly people in the housing complex. In this way, the security center in the estate is composed of the various monitoring information 10 necessary for the safe living of elderly residents in the estate, the life support, and the mechanical monitoring means 10 that supports human watching and watching from the side. 22 is an elderly resident in the housing complex as a local resident, and is operated by a pre-determined healthy senior citizen or a local resident such as the NPO corporation 17, etc. It is possible to provide a business model for the in-house monitoring system in which a community is formed. Furthermore, since the mechanical monitoring means 10 has an alarm output means, an alarm is output when there is a change. About 2 times a day, the safety center 22 can check the life information and abnormalities of elderly residents, and if an alarm is output or an abnormality is detected, the safety center 22 will rush to check the situation and provide various support. As can be done, the operation of the safety center 22 can provide a business model of the residential area monitoring system that is performed by local residents such as healthy elderly residents, residents' associations, or NPO corporations.
